]> git.kernelconcepts.de Git - karo-tx-linux.git/blobdiff - drivers/irqchip/irqchip.c
irqchip / ACPI: Add probing infrastructure for ACPI-based irqchips
[karo-tx-linux.git] / drivers / irqchip / irqchip.c
index afd1af3dfe5a231692cd0904c5b5a18e5c3f8245..1ee773e98f5f91d55403da89beae1b8809da7ecd 100644 (file)
@@ -8,7 +8,7 @@
  * warranty of any kind, whether express or implied.
  */
 
-#include <linux/acpi_irq.h>
+#include <linux/acpi.h>
 #include <linux/init.h>
 #include <linux/of_irq.h>
 #include <linux/irqchip.h>
@@ -27,6 +27,8 @@ extern struct of_device_id __irqchip_of_table[];
 void __init irqchip_init(void)
 {
        of_irq_init(__irqchip_of_table);
-
-       acpi_irq_init();
+#if defined(CONFIG_ARM64) && defined(CONFIG_ACPI)
+       acpi_gic_init();        /* Temporary hack */
+#endif
+       acpi_probe_device_table(irqchip);
 }